
CU International's mission is to help international students, both
in answering their questions and concerns about life on campus, and in
organizing social activities where they can meet each other and other
CU students. CU International aims to make life for international
students in Colorado as comfortable as possible, and to provide
international students with many opportunities to try new things and
meet new people.
During the week before classes start, CU International plays a key
role in the international student Welcome Week by helping with
check-ins, sitting on question/answer panels, leading tours of the CU
campus and the Boulder/Denver area, and organizing social events like
coffee hours, dinners and bowling. During Welcome Week, CU
International members make themselves available at most international
events for any questions the new international students might have
about adjusting to life in Boulder.
During the rest of the year, CU International organizes a variety of
regular (and less regular) social events. CU International members meet
weekly for dinner try out one of the local Boulder restaurants. They also organize a weekly International Coffee Hour
where all CU students are welcome to come, have some coffee or snacks
and chat with international students. CU International organizes a
variety of other social activities including hikes, dancing, and ski
trips.
